Summary- With the game knotted at 3-3 in the 2nd quarter. Hempfield looked very comfortable and effective running a set offense, and dominating face-off (Pennsbury starting F/O man Evan Caterson not playing.) Hempfield went up 4-3 in Q2, but Pennsbury knotted it at 4-4 just before the half. The 2nd half was a completely different story as Pennsbury went on a 10 goal rampage spanning the 3rd and 4th quarters - lots of transition goals offset with dodges from x - resulting in either a shot, or a cross-crease pass to the open guy on the other side. With the score at 14-4 and having shut out the Black Knights in the second half, PHS pulled all the starters with 4 minutes remaining in the game and Hempfield was able to force the action for 2 goals and a 14-6 final score.
Pennsbury is now 12-1 overall looking forward to a Tuesday showdown at home against SOL National rival Abington.
